TNB to introduce online transaction at month-end
TNB said its staff are ready to assist during the system transition period in July and would try their best to reduce the hiccups.
Tenaga Nasional Bhd (TNB) is launching a one-stop portal at www.mytnb.com.my at the end of this month to enable customers carry out transactions 'without borders'.
In a statement here, TNB said its 8.6 million customers could make various transactions and get access to information they wanted.
"During the system transition period in July, minor hiccups may occur for several transactions.
"However, our staff are ready to assist and would try their best to reduce the hiccups," said TNB.
Transactions that can be made include supply application, change of tenancy and closing account.
The others are deposit refund in a shorter period and debited directly to customer's bank account and bill payment.
Customers can also get access to information, electricity consumption trend and search for other portals related to the power industry.
